This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] DAC39RF20:DAC39RF20 FR/TRIG 接口间歇性

Guru**** 2766295 points

Other Parts Discussed in Thread: DAC39RF20

请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/data-converters-group/data-converters/f/data-converters-forum/1613970/dac39rf20-dac39rf20-fr-trig-interface-intermittence

器件型号: DAC39RF20

我们使用 DAC39RF20、尝试启动并运行 FR 接口。 我们使用 FPGA 对 SPI 进行编程、然后移交给 FR 接口以实现快速频率变化、但无法让器件使用 FR 接口进行响应/更改频率。  

由于 FR 接口使用 TRIG 引脚、因此我们通过将 TRIG_TYPE 从 5 更改为 4 并直接驱动触发器上的位来设定频率来进行调试。 这应该会触发编程到寄存器中的频率的频率变化、但只会间歇性地出现问题(在触发状态的 1 和~4 变化之间进行随机变化以获得要移动的频率)。

我们测量了进入 TRIG 引脚的信号、它们看起来具有适当的电压电平 (1.8V)、没有明显的反弹。  

有哪些调试步骤可确定此间歇性的原因、它是否与我们无法通过 FR 接口编程有关?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    像往常一样、当您发布问题时、您会自己找到答案。 结果表明、0x2807 处的寄存器在数据表中被错误地标记为 FR_EN(可能应为 PFIR_FR_EN)。 设置实际 FR_EN 寄存器 (0x21) 后、器件似乎按设计工作。